隨筆 - 117  文章 - 72  trackbacks - 0

          聲明:原創作品(標有[原]字樣)轉載時請注明出處,謝謝。

          常用鏈接

          常用設置
          常用軟件
          常用命令
           

          訂閱

          訂閱

          留言簿(7)

          隨筆分類(130)

          隨筆檔案(123)

          搜索

          •  

          積分與排名

          • 積分 - 155988
          • 排名 - 389

          最新評論

          VC6.0 error LNK2001: unresolved external symbol _main
          [時間]:2008-8-12
          [問題]:
          最簡單的Win32程序示例:
          #include <windows.h>
          int WINAPI WinMain (HINSTANCE hInstance,
                           HINSTANCE hPrevInstance,
                           PSTR szCmdLine,
                           int iCmdShow)
          {
          MessageBox(NULL, "Hello, Win32!", "問候", MB_OK) ;  

          return 0 ;
          }
          在使用VC6.0直接編譯cpp文件時(未通過AppWizard)出現錯誤:
          error LNK2001: unresolved external symbol _main
          在創建項目時, 不使用AppWizard向導, 就有可能在編譯時產生很多連接錯誤,
          如error LNK2001錯誤, 典型的錯誤提示有:
          error LNK2001: unresolved external symbol _main
          [解決]:
          error LNK2001: unresolved external symbol _main.
          這是Windows子系統設置錯誤.
          Windows項目要使用Windows子系統, 而不是Console, 可以這樣設置:
          [Project] --> [Settings] --> 選擇"Link"屬性頁,
          在Project Options中將/subsystem:console改成/subsystem:windows。

          文章來源:http://wintys.blog.51cto.com/425414/92284
          posted on 2009-03-18 12:02 天堂露珠 閱讀(1084) 評論(0)  編輯  收藏 所屬分類: Error
          主站蜘蛛池模板: 宝清县| 汾西县| 湘潭市| 南召县| 烟台市| 丹寨县| 石屏县| 东至县| 樟树市| 青浦区| 敖汉旗| 金坛市| 南京市| 秦安县| 屯留县| 夏津县| 井陉县| 康乐县| 翁源县| 滨海县| 册亨县| 建瓯市| 蒙自县| 承德市| 泰安市| 囊谦县| 达尔| 锦州市| 防城港市| 阿拉尔市| 广州市| 安仁县| 巴南区| 邵阳县| 邹城市| 颍上县| 西丰县| 博湖县| 昭平县| 醴陵市| 阳原县|